Packaging Manager jobs in Lawrence, KS

Packaging Manager manages and oversees the packaging staff on designated shift to achieve operational objectives. Observes, analyzes, and researches packaging line operation to develop and implement scientific and efficient process. Being a Packaging Manager implements quality control check to ensure the packaging meets environment, health, and safety regulations. Provides staff with directions on materials and equipment for each package. Additionally, Packaging Manager may require a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a head of a unit/department. The Packaging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. Extensive knowledge of department processes. To be a Packaging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 to 3 years supervisory experience may be required.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Packaging Operator
  • The Krusteaz Company
  • Manhattan, KS FULL_TIME
  • About the Position

    The Packaging Operator sets up and runs food manufacturing equipment and performs other associated necessary functions to ensure a quality and compliant finished product.

    Essential Functions: Other duties, responsibilities, and activities may change or be assigned at any time.

    • Hand sorting, case packing, stacking pallets, and replenishing supplies.
    • Performs quality checks on all materials, ingredients, and finished product.
    • Performs preventive maintenance.
    • Active member of an AM Team associated with one of the lines
    • Performs daily and monthly sanitation of packaging areas.
    • Implements, maintains, and performs self audits on sanitation systems to assure ongoing full compliance to all applicable Federal, State, Local and Corporate regulations.
    • Take preventive action where needed to protect any product in the facility from contamination or adulteration.
    • Ensure documentation and work completed in the packaging area meets all requirements of Process quality, Compliance Quality, Food Safety Programs and Safety.
    • Provides assistance in training employees as changes or new methods arise.
    • Miscellaneous duties as assigned.

    Position Requirements

    To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als qualified with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

     Technical

    • Operate and troubleshoot packaging equipment and supplies.

    Communication

    • Demonstrate effective verbal communications skills.

    Characteristics & Attributes

    • Work in a safe manner following plant safety requirements
    • Safeguard product quality and follows GMP, housekeeping, and food safety guidelines.
    • Manage time efficiently and effectively, self-motivated.
    • Manage multiple tasks and priorities.
    • Develop good working relationships with fellow team members.
    • Ability to work independently, and to ensure specific assignments are completed within established time frames
    • Consistently maintain an acceptable level of attendance

    Education and/or Experience:

    • High school diploma or GED.
    • Previous food processing experience is preferred.
    • Must be flexible to work any shift when required, and work overtime when necessary.
    • Must be able to lift up to and including 50 lb. bags throughout an 8 hour day.
    • Must be able to pass if requested basic reading/arithmetic test, physical agility test, background check, chemical screening and reference check prior to employment.                                    

    Physical Demands and Work Environment:

    As a member of the operations team, you will be exposed to a variety of physical demands that require you to lift heavy objects (up to 50 pounds), climb stairs, exert energy, bend, twist and squat, and use tools and equipment.  Employees stand and walk on concrete while wearing steel-toed shoes, uniforms, hair nets, bump caps, gloves and safety glasses.  The use of company–provided hearing protection is also required in stated areas.

Lawrence is the county seat of Douglas County and sixth-largest city in Kansas. It is located in the northeastern sector of the state, astride Interstate 70, between the Kansas and Wakarusa Rivers. As of the 2010 census, the city's population was 87,643. Lawrence is a college town and the home to both the University of Kansas and Haskell Indian Nations University. Lawrence was founded by the New England Emigrant Aid Company, and was named for Amos Adams Lawrence, a Republican abolitionist originally from Massachusetts, who offered financial aid and support for the settlement.
